Take any companions off, if they kill anything it also fails challenge. Your goal is to run around and break boxes, which will sometimes contain small charges. Use an unranked melee weapon to break boxes so it doesn't kill anything in the sweep. I usually use Wisp and bunny hop around

Legend 5 here, so I've used damn near every weapon there is. I prefer to look for warframe & weapon synergy. Here's a few examples to look for:

Ash with Destreza Prime. It works well with his 3 and passive

Citrine with any low crit chance, high crit damage weapon. Her 4 force triggers red crits on hit. Sporothrix and (Kuva) Nukor are two weapons that immediately come to mind

Garuda, Oraxia and Saryn all like (Kuva) Sobek with the Acid Shells mod. Garuda and Oraxia thanks to their 4th abilities, Saryn due to her 3rd.

Harrow and Scourge. I think Scourge is buggy if you aren't the host though, so keep that in mind if you rely on the headshot magnetism

Lavos with Valence Formation and Sampotes. Lets you proc status on the big aftershocks and all but negates the recent-ish slam nerfs

Mag. There are a tonne of weapons that work great with Mag. Check out RowanIsAMagMain on YouTube. Goes really in-depth with Mag's synergies and what works / doesn't work with her bubble. Tl;dr I like Huva Hek. Alt fire big boom

Nekros with Ripkas and the mod Amalgam Ripkas True Steel. Makes it so enemy corpses split in 2, doubling your looting. Worth noting it doesn't need to be melee weapon kills either, just need Ripkas and the Amalgam mod

Dedicate one person to pick up motes. Someone with passive dps here helps. Finality's Augur or Anarchy would be a good idea. Tag the boss when possible, but focus on dunking motes first.

Dedicate 2nd person to kill knights and hobgoblins. I took this role and used a Praedyths with enhanced Kinetic Tremors and Frenzy. Tremors helped to secure yellow bar kills and thankfully don't send motes flying. Boss dps is your 2nd focus here. Hobgoblins are a pain

Third person be primary dps

There's an impressive video floating on YouTube with a Titan who solo 2 phased the boss on Ultimatum. Think they used Temptation's Hook, Lost Signal and Le Monarche


Extras: Cover is sparse, but the boss' darkness "be gone" orb has a large aoe. Dont hug the cubes too closely or you'll still get sent backwards

Kill order - moths , then the 3 boomer knights around the arena. The knights don't respawn until you've done a dps phase. I'd sit on the skull at the start, take out moths, then fully charge a thunderclap into the boomer on the skull. Would kill as long as it didn't spawn with a moth shielding it. I'd then snipe the one down by the "void Titan" water wall.

Deepsight was the biggest killer for my group, but we found a way to take advantage of boss aggro - she fires in a volley. When the boss starts shooting at someone, she won't change targets until she pauses. If you aren't the target of the arc barrage, you're free to grab deepsight. Beware the boss pausing her barrage as you go to grab deepsight. She seems liable to re-target whoever is closest to her.

Found the most reliable method was to run and grab it as soon as she was shooting someone that wasn't me. Worked every time. An invis hunter can bypass this aggro mechanic altogether.

We would set up the boss damage zone by checking each Guardian symbol relative to where the symbol is in the arena. We would always make sure to never dunk the final symbol in the chest cavity area (it's a deathtrap for DPS).

Always have 2 people in the room with the boss when dunking buffs. See my comment about taking boss aggro and deepsight. 3rd person can safely plink away another guardian in the meantime. Ideally 3rd is invis as they can solo deepsight for easy dunking.

I ran arc Titan with Precious Scars. Cruel Mercy was my go-to restoration gun of choice. Queenbreaker for DPS with Particle artefact mod. 2x arc resist on chest piece, 1x concussive dampener. My special - Critical Anomaly. Chill Clip and Choas Reshaped. Tac mag to get 4 capacity for 3x chill clip shots. Critical Anomaly would chew through boomer knights and the sword wielding boss knights too

Final tip : don't be afraid to super away to safety. It's better to wait 5 minutes to recharge a super than to wipe the run and start from scratch again.

A long while back, Bungie made a PvP change to stop people shooting during a slide and then following up with a melee. Melee now gets disabled if you shoot during a slide. I think Bungie's reasoning was that it was too good a wombo combo to secure a 1 shot. This was due to Titan shoulder charges and Warlock arc surge melees.

Said change also killed the PvE combo for "slide -> shoot (with 12p) -> shoulder charge.

For more context - the 12p buff doesn't last long enough to shoot and then start a sprint to get a shoulder charge off
